California High School Volleyball - Cuyama Valley tips Shandon
October 7, 2022: New Cuyama, CA 93254 The crowd at Friday's league bout between the Cuyama Valley Bears (New Cuyama, CA) and the visiting Shandon Outlaws (Shandon, CA), saw Cuyama Valley's volleyball squad nip Shandon by a tally of 3-2.
With the win, Cuyama Valley upgrades its record to 3-9 on the year. The Bears travel to Coastal Christian (Pismo Beach, CA) to play the Conquerors in a Coast Valley bout on Tuesday, October 11. The Conquerors go into the bout with a record of 17-8. Coastal Christian won 3-0 in their recent league bout against San Luis Obispo Classical Academy (San Luis Obispo, CA)
The Outlaws now own a 12-6 record. They play next when they host Valley Christian Academy for a Coast Valley bout on Tuesday, October 11. Shandon will play a Lions squad coming off a 3-2 league loss to Coast Union (Cambria, CA). The Lions record now stands at 10-7.
